  • Value of Production Index decelerates

Based on the preliminary results of the Monthly Integrated Survey of Selected Industries (MISSI), Value of Production Index (VaPI) for manufacturing declined by 2.1 percent in May 2019. During the same month of the previous year, the annual rate of VaPI went up by 14.8 percent.

The downtrend  was due to the annual decreases observed in seven major industry groups with two-digit negative annual rates as follows: leather products (-18.3%), food manufacturing (-17.7%), miscellaneous manufactures (-15.6%), and basic metals (-13.5%). Refer to Tables1-A and 1.

 

  • Volume of Production Index declines

Volume of Production Index (VoPI) also posted a decrease of 4.0 percent in May 2019. It posted a two-digit annual growth of 13.0 percent in April 2018.

Six major industry groups registered annual decreases with furniture and fixtures and food manufacturing posting the highest annual declines of 35.0 percent and 14.0 percent, respectively. Refer to Tables 1-B and 2

  • Value of Net Sales Index sustains a positive growth

The Value of Net Sales Index (VaNSI) reflected a year-on-year increase of 0.7 percent in May 2019. Its annual rate during the same month of the previous year was higher at 13.1 percent.

The increment was brought about by the improved performance of 10 major industry groups with two-digit increases as follows: wood and wood products (43.7%), fabricated metal products (28.3%), transport equipment (17.1%), and petroleum products (14.6%). Refer to Tables 2-A and 3.

 

  • Volume of Net Sales Index decreases

The Volume of Net Sales Index (VoNSI) declined by 1.3 percent in May 2019 as compared with its annual growth of 11.3 percent during the same period last year.

Eleven major industry groups pulled down the VoNSI which was led by furniture and fixtures (-36.0%), and textiles (-20.4%). Refer to Tables 2-B and 4.

  • Average Capacity Utilization Rate is highest for petroleum products

Average capacity utilization rate for total manufacturing in May 2019 was posted at 84.4 percent. Fifty-five percent or 11 of the 20 major industries had at least 80 percent capacity utilization rates during the month. These were:

  • petroleum products (89.5%)
  • basic metals (88.8%)
  • non-metallic mineral products (86.4%)
  • machinery except electrical (86.4%)
  • food manufacturing (85.3%)
  • chemical products (85.2%)
  • electrical machinery (85.1%)
  • paper and paper products (83.9%)
  • rubber and plastic products (83.3%)
  • wood and wood products (82.0%)
  • textiles (80.4%)

The proportion of establishments that operated at full capacity (90% to 100%) was more than one-fourth (27.6%) of the total number of establishments for manufacturing in May 2019. About 53.6 percent of the total establishments during the month operated at 70 percent to 89 percent capacity, while almost one-fifth (18.8%) operated below 70 percent capacity.
